Dennis:

Reports such as yours, plus the actual cost of the Go Westy starter, is why I opted for an adapter plate (I used Karl’s plate) and a {gear reduction} diesel starter from the VW TD/TDi engines (prior to the Pumpe-Duse).

> On 05-Sep-2016, at 07:24, Dennis Jowell <dennisjowell@GMAIL.COM> wrote: > > I've had my Gowesty starter for two years plus for 22,000 miles starter does not work now. Is this typical of this type a starter? For a while I noticed that the brushes get stuck then I'll tap the starter and it would turn over, now that wont work anymore. 12.5 volts a starter. Connections are clean + light application of dielectric grease. Is there a better starter out there? Gowesty wants $299 for a new one. I have no idea as far as a warranty.
